How should I use and maintain the wrench to maximize its life?
- Use the extended handle to apply controlled leverage for high-torque tasks - Keep the chrome finish clean and dry to prevent corrosion - Wipe off any grease or debris after use and store hanging via the security hole - Inspect for any signs of wear or cracks and discontinue use if damage is detected
What safety considerations should I keep in mind when using slugging wrenches?
- Wear appropriate eye protection and gloves - Ensure the fastener size matches 46mm before engaging - Apply force gradually and avoid impact or misalignment that could cause slippage - Do not use the wrench as a pry bar or for unintended leverage - Use the hanging hole for proper storage to prevent accidental damage

How do I install or position this wrench on a 46mm fastener correctly?
- Align the box-end fully with the 46mm fastener to avoid rounding - Apply steady, controlled force using the extended handle for leverage - Ensure there’s no obstruction and the tool is perpendicular to the fastener to prevent slipping - When finished, hang the wrench via the security hole to keep it accessible and protected
